WebThe prostate gland is located on the anterior surface of the rectum. The biopsy is performed through the rectum using an ultrasound probe, similar to the digital rectal exam of the prostate. The procedure lasts approximately 15-20 minutes. Local anesthesia will be administered at the time of biopsy to numb the prostate. WebWhat happens after an MRI-guided biopsy? You may resume your normal activities and diet immediately. You may be sore for a few days, and you also may see small amounts of blood in your urine, stool, and semen. WebBlood in the urine – It is normal to have slightly red tinged urine or urine that resembles a rose or red wine color. This may last from 12 hours to 3 weeks after the biopsy.
